Description

Application
Pharmaceuticals- Used in syrups ointments and as a laxative. Cosmetics & skincare- Acts as a moisturizer in creams lotions and soaps. Food industry- Used as a sweetener humectant and preservative. Industrial- use In making explosives (like nitroglycerin) plastics and resins. Medical- Used to reduce eye pressure (in conditions like glaucoma).

General Description
Glycerol is odourless colorless viscous in nature and exists as a sweet tasting liquid. It can be derived naturally as well as from petrochemical feedstock. Glycerol has a wide variety of applications and is one of the most valuable and versatile chemical substances in nature. It can be used as an emollient solvent sweetening agent in pharmaceutical formulations cosmetics foodstuffs and toiletries. It is very stable and can be easily stored under normal temperature also it is non-irritating and has no adverse impact to the environment.
